Creates a forum topic.

Parameters

array $forum: A forum array.

bool $container: TRUE if $forum is a container; FALSE otherwise.

Return value

object|null The created topic node or NULL if the forum is a container.

Code

public function createForumTopic($forum, $container = FALSE) {
  // Generate a random subject/body.
  $title = $this->randomMachineName(20);
  $body = $this->randomMachineName(200);
  $edit = [
    'title[0][value]' => $title,
    'body[0][value]' => $body,
  ];
  $tid = $forum['tid'];
  // Create the forum topic, preselecting the forum ID via a URL parameter.
  $this->drupalGet('node/add/forum', [
    'query' => [
      'forum_id' => $tid,
    ],
  ]);
  $this->submitForm($edit, 'Save');
  if ($container) {
    $this->assertSession()
      ->pageTextNotContains("Forum topic {$title} has been created.");
    $this->assertSession()
      ->pageTextContains("The item {$forum['name']} is a forum container, not a forum.");
    return;
  }
  else {
    $this->assertSession()
      ->pageTextContains("Forum topic {$title} has been created.");
    $this->assertSession()
      ->pageTextNotContains("The item {$forum['name']} is a forum container, not a forum.");
    // Verify that the creation message contains a link to a node.
    $this->assertSession()
      ->elementExists('xpath', '//div[@data-drupal-messages]//a[contains(@href, "node/")]');
  }
  // Retrieve node object, ensure that the topic was created and in the proper forum.
  $node = $this->drupalGetNodeByTitle($title);
  $this->assertNotNull($node, "Node {$title} was loaded");
  $this->assertEquals($tid, $node->taxonomy_forums->target_id, 'Saved forum topic was in the expected forum');
  // View forum topic.
  $this->drupalGet('node/' . $node->id());
  $this->assertSession()
    ->pageTextContains($title);
  $this->assertSession()
    ->pageTextContains($body);
  return $node;
}
